Electrochemical characterization of the polyaniline-based oxidase-peroxidase electrode and application to the enzyme switch

抄録

The electrochemical properties of oxidase-peroxidase co-immobilized electrode fabricated electrochemically deposited polyaniline (PAn) were investigated. It found that electro-conductivity of a PAn film was necessary for the oxidase-HRP to show its function. Based on this result, the enzyme switch utilizing the oxidase-HRP system was developed by utilizing electro-conductivity changes of a PAn film. It was found that a PAn film lost its electro-conductivity by the oxidase-HRP reactions, and the oxidized PAn film obtained electro-conductivity again by applying + 100 mV vs. Ag/AgCl to a PAn film.
